Running a company in India comes with several legal responsibilities, and one of the most important among them is ROC Compliance. Whether you own a private limited company, OPC, or LLP, staying compliant with the Registrar of Companies (ROC) is essential to avoid penalties, legal notices, and business disruptions.
At GST Wale, we often meet business owners who are focused on growth but unintentionally miss important ROC yearly compliance deadlines. This can lead to hefty fines and unnecessary stress later. That’s why having a proper annual compliance checklist India businesses can follow is extremely important.
If your company needs professional guidance for ROC Compliance, it is always better to act early rather than wait for notices from the MCA portal.
In this article, we will explain the complete annual ROC Compliance checklist in simple language so that business owners can easily understand their responsibilities and complete their company compliance tasks India on time.
ROC Compliance refers to the mandatory legal filings and disclosures that companies registered under the Companies Act, 2013 must submit to the Registrar of Companies (ROC).
These filings help the Ministry of Corporate Affairs (MCA) keep company records updated regarding:
Every registered company, even if it has no business activity, must complete ROC yearly compliance requirements annually.
Many entrepreneurs assume ROC Compliance matters only for large companies. However, even small startups and dormant companies must comply with MCA annual filing requirements.
Here’s why timely compliance is important:
Late filing fees under ROC Compliance can increase daily. In some cases, penalties may go into lakhs of rupees.
Non-compliance can lead to company strike-off by ROC.
Investors, banks, and financial institutions often check ROC records before approvals.
Proper ROC yearly compliance improves trust among lenders and investors.
Continuous non-filing can result in director disqualification under the Companies Act.
Below is a practical business compliance checklist that every company should follow annually.
Private limited companies are required to conduct a minimum number of board meetings every year.
For OPCs and small companies, compliance requirements may be relaxed.
Proper documentation of meetings is an important part of ROC Compliance.
Every company must conduct an AGM within the prescribed timeline.
For most companies in India, the AGM deadline falls on or before 30th September.
Missing AGM deadlines can directly affect ROC Compliance status.
One of the most critical MCA annual filing requirements is filing Form AOC-4.
Form AOC-4 must generally be filed within 30 days of the AGM.
Failure to file this form on time attracts additional filing fees.
Form MGT-7 is another mandatory ROC Compliance filing for companies.
MGT-7 must be filed within 60 days of the AGM.
This is one of the most important company compliance tasks India businesses should never ignore.
Every director with a DIN (Director Identification Number) must complete DIR-3 KYC annually.
This requirement is often missed by small businesses during ROC yearly compliance.
Companies are legally required to maintain updated statutory registers.
Maintaining proper records supports smooth ROC Compliance during inspections or audits.
Auditor-related filings are also part of annual ROC Compliance requirements.
Professional handling of auditor compliance reduces future legal complications.
Although ROC Compliance is separate from GST and Income Tax, all records should match across departments.
Mismatch in records may trigger notices from authorities.
At GST Wale, we advise businesses to align ROC filings with tax filings for smoother compliance management.
Many companies face penalties due to avoidable errors.
The most common issue in ROC yearly compliance is delayed filing.
Errors in balance sheet reporting can create legal complications.
Even inactive companies have ROC Compliance obligations.
Changes in director details must be updated promptly.
Lack of documentation can create issues during scrutiny.
The MCA has become stricter regarding company compliance tasks India businesses must complete.
In many cases, companies end up paying far more in penalties than the actual professional compliance cost.
Here are some practical suggestions from GST Wale to simplify annual compliance checklist India requirements.
Track important due dates in advance.
Avoid last-minute accounting work before filing.
Quarterly reviews help identify missing documents early.
Experienced consultants help reduce errors and filing delays.
MCA portal traffic often increases near deadlines.
Yes. Even dormant or inactive companies must complete certain ROC yearly compliance filings.
Late filing attracts additional fees and may result in legal action or director disqualification.
Yes, most private limited companies must hold an AGM every financial year.
Technically, some forms can be filed directly, but professional guidance helps avoid mistakes and penalties.
ROC Compliance relates to company law filings with MCA, while GST compliance relates to indirect tax filings under GST law.
Managing ROC Compliance is not just about avoiding penalties—it is about maintaining the legal health and credibility of your company. From AGM meetings and MCA annual filing to maintaining statutory registers, every compliance step plays a vital role in smooth business operations.
Unfortunately, many businesses in India ignore annual filings until they receive notices from authorities. A proactive approach can save both money and stress.
At GST Wale, we help companies handle complete ROC yearly compliance with accuracy, timely filing, and expert guidance. Whether you are a startup, private limited company, OPC, or growing business, our experts ensure your annual compliance checklist India requirements are managed professionally.
If you want hassle-free ROC Compliance support, connect with GST Wale today and keep your business fully compliant throughout the year.